Location: Greenside Row, Edinburgh, EH1 3AN
Rate of Pay: £36,500 per annum
Working Pattern: Monday - Friday, daytime hours, occasional evening overtime
Key Responsibilities
- To prepare and oversee all preparation of food to the highest standard
- Look after the Staff Dining leading a team of 7 chefs up to 300+ covers daily
- To produce food in a timely fashion to ensure smooth service to the customers
- To ensure that all appropriate ingredients are available for the menus
- To develop and plan menus that are in line with client and customer expectations
- To be creative when menu planning and including the client and customers
- Pride yourself on food quality and hygiene standards
- Overall responsibility for managing the kitchen team
- Provide feedback and coaching on performance
- To ensure that the kitchen team have completed up to date COSHH and Food Hygiene training
